One of those perfectly timed gag covers that DC did so well in 1946, this issue of More Fun Comics features Dover and Clover — those "slap-happy twins" — in a bedroom mix-up that's already funny before you read a word. One twin sits on the edge of the bed in yellow pajamas and a nightcap, baffled about which side he fell asleep on, while the other grins smugly from under the covers with a punchline that lands just right. Henry Boltinoff's clean, expressive linework gives the duo a warm, rubbery charm that makes their confused-identity humor feel genuinely effortless.
